Directions

  1.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at.
  2. Sprinkle duck with salt and pepper.
  3. Add duck to pan; saut 5 minutes. Turn and saut an additional 2 minutes or until desired degree of doneness.
  4. Add vinegar; cook 1 minute.
  5. Remove from heat; let stand 10 minutes.
  6. Cut duck diagonally across grain into thin strips.
  7. Spoon 1/2 cup peas onto each of 4 plates; place 1 breast half on each plate.
  8. Drizzle with vinegar sauce; garnish with parsley, if desired.
